CURRENT# ai-researcher The AI Researcher is an AI agent that utilizes Claude 3 and SERPAPI to perform comprehensive research on a given topic. It breaks down the research process into subtopics, generates individual reports for each subtopic, and then combines them into a final comprehensive report.
